Indicted Rep. George Santos (R-NY) said he will not run for re-election after a House Ethics Committee report accused the congressman of fraud and other crimes.
Santos told Semafor that he was dropping plans to run for re-election.
The Ethics Committee concluded that Santos "sought to fraudulently exploit every aspect of his House candidacy for his own personal financial profit."
The lawmaker is also facing federal charges related to his campaign.
